Почему мы используем f и L для чисел с плавающей запятой и long, в то время как мы не используем b и s для byte и short?
Я спросил ChatGPT, и он сказал, что, поскольку byte и short могут поместиться в int нет никакой двусмысленности. но если мы посмотрим на это таким образом, float также может поместиться в double.
Примечание: возможно, программисты хотят, чтобы компилятор работал таким образом. Если ответа не будет, я приму это как ответ.
Подробнее здесь: https://stackoverflow.com/questions/785 ... -use-b-and
Мобильная версия